What Are Personal AI Ecosystems?

A personal AI ecosystem is a network of interconnected artificial intelligence systems that work together to assist an individual across various aspects of life.
Rather than using separate tools independently, users interact with a coordinated ecosystem capable of:
- Managing schedules
- Organizing information
- Providing recommendations
- Monitoring health
- Assisting with learning
- Supporting financial decisions
- Automating daily tasks
- Enhancing productivity
These ecosystems combine multiple technologies, including:
- AI assistants
- Smart devices
- Cloud platforms
- Wearable technologies
- Generative AI systems
- Personalized recommendation engines
The goal is to create a seamless and intelligent digital environment centered around the individual.

Digital Literacy Beyond Search Engines
For decades, digital literacy meant knowing how to search for information online.
That definition is rapidly changing.
Tomorrow’s workforce must understand:
AI Collaboration
Learning to work effectively with intelligent systems.
Prompt Engineering
Communicating with AI through clear instructions.
Information Verification
Evaluating:
- Accuracy
- Bias
- Credibility
Human oversight remains indispensable.
Data Privacy
Understanding how information is collected and used.
Critical Thinking
Human judgment becomes increasingly valuable in an AI-rich world.
Digital literacy now extends far beyond search engines.

1. What is a personal AI ecosystem?
A personal AI ecosystem is an interconnected network of AI assistants, smart devices, and digital services that work together to support an individual’s daily life, productivity, learning, health, and decision-making.
2. How are AI agents different from traditional apps?
AI agents can perform tasks autonomously, adapt to preferences, and collaborate with other systems, whereas traditional apps typically require manual interaction.
3. Why is digital literacy beyond search engines important?
Modern digital literacy includes AI collaboration, prompt engineering, information verification, privacy awareness, and critical thinking, which are essential skills in an AI-driven world
